Key Points
Multilayer insulation films enhance thermal conductivity significantly, with improvements noted up to 30%.
Key features include a novel design mimicking biological structures for better heat management.
Observational analysis of thermal and mechanical properties was conducted across various film compositions.
Highlights potential applications in energy-efficient systems, yet further testing in real-world conditions is required.
